Oh, yes, there is plenty of good and bad Blues. Here's a look:
Good Blues:
Lead Belly (I ain't gettin' my head got in no drivin'-wheel)
Robert Johnson
Charley Patton
Son House
Son Simms Four (with Muddy Waters)
Muddy Waters (pre-Chicago)
BB King (pre-1970)
Skip James
Blind Willie Johnson
Elmore James
Howlin' Wolf
Sonny Boy Williamson
Jelly Roll Morton
Mississippi John Hurt
Willie Dixon
John Lee Hooker
-and so on.


Other good Blues artists you've probably never heard of - and probabaly never will again:
WC Handy
Memphis Jug Band
Lightnin' Hopkins
Big Bill Broonzy
Humphrey Lyttelton
Ray Charles (I know you knoy Ray, but have you heard the Genius play some mean, dirty Blues?)
Jimmy Yancy
Pinetop Perkins
Salif Keita
-and so on.

Here are some that are not too appealing, or down right suck:
Stevie Ray Vaughn (the Cock Rocker of Blues. Get the fuck outta town)
Bobby Bland
Billie Holiday (she did play Blues, but in the stylings of jazz. sorry, ladies)
The Bad Blues Band (yeah, no shit)
Keb' Mo'

That's all I got for now.
